It is with deep regret that we announce we will be closing Camp Chawanakee for the summer of 2020. With respect to the impacts of the COVID-19 Coronavirus the Executive Committee feels the safety and well-being of our youth members, customers and employees remain the Sequoia Council Boy Scouts of America's top priority. To all units that are impacted by this we are offering the option to move your reservation over to a 2021 Summer Camp Reservation or a full cash refund. Scouting strives to enable youth to become better individuals and good leaders. To do this though it requires the help of leaders who are ready to assist and aid on their path through scouting. To help adults be ready to do this there is nothing better Wood Badge Training. Wood Badge courses aim to make Scouters better leaders by teaching advanced leadership skills, and by creating a bond and commitment to the Scout movement. Courses generally have a combined classroom and pr...actical outdoors-based phase followed by a Wood Badge ticket, also known as the project phase. By "working the ticket", participants put their newly gained experience into practice to attain ticket goals aiding the Scouting movement.
